Optional Public Holidays in Pakistan 2025
Muslims festivals Gazette Holidays 2025 are coming now in the New Year 2025 and people enjoy themselves in this period of leave conducted on the different days of the year.
Optional Pakistan Public Holidays in Pakistan in 2025 All the minority inhabitants enjoying the optional holidays are denominational and may be allowed at the discretion of the Head of Office, provided that work is not suffered.
Date | Day | Holiday Name | Type |
1-Jan | Wednesday | New Year’s Day | Optional Holiday |
27-Jan | Monday | Shab e-Meraj (Tentative Date) | Optional Holiday |
2-Feb | Sunday | Basant Panchami | Optional Holiday |
5-Feb | Wednesday | Kashmir Day | Public Holiday |
14-Feb | Friday | Shab e-Barat (Tentative Date) | Optional Holiday |
1-Mar | Saturday | Ramadan Start (Tentative Date) | Observance |
13-Mar | Thursday | Holi | Optional Holiday |
20-Mar | Thursday | March Equinox | Season |
23-Mar | Sunday | Pakistan Day | Public Holiday |
31-Mar | Monday | Eid-ul-Fitr (Tentative Date) | Public Holiday |
1-Apr | Tuesday | Eid-ul-Fitr Holiday (Tentative Date) | Public Holiday |
2-Apr | Wednesday | Eid-ul-Fitr Holiday (Tentative Date) | Public Holiday |
3-Apr | Thursday | Eid-ul-Fitr Holiday (Tentative Date) | Public Holiday |
14-Apr | Monday | Baisakhi | Optional Holiday |
18-Apr | Friday | Good Friday | Optional Holiday |
20-Apr | Sunday | Easter Sunday | Observance |
21-Apr | Monday | Easter Monday | Optional Holiday |
21-Apr | Monday | Ridván | Optional Holiday |
1-May | Thursday | Labour Day | Public Holiday |
12-May | Monday | Buddha Purnima | Optional Holiday |
7-Jun | Saturday | Eid al-Adha (Tentative Date) | Public Holiday |
8-Jun | Sunday | Eid al-Adha Holiday (Tentative Date) | Public Holiday |
9-Jun | Monday | Eid al-Adha Holiday (Tentative Date) | Public Holiday |
21-Jun | Saturday | June Solstice | Season |
1-Jul | Tuesday | July 1 Bank Holiday | Bank Holiday |
5-Jul | Saturday | Ashura (Tentative Date) | Public Holiday |
6-Jul | Sunday | Ashura Holiday (Tentative Date) | Public Holiday |
9-Aug | Saturday | Raksha Bandhan | Hindu Holiday |
14-Aug | Thursday | Independence Day | Public Holiday |
15-Aug | Friday | Chelum (Tentative Date) | Optional Holiday |
27-Aug | Wednesday | Ganesh Chaturthi | Hindu Holiday |
4-Sep | Thursday | Giarhwin Sharief (Tentative Date) | Optional Holiday |
5-Sep | Friday | Eid Milad un-Nabi (Tentative Date) | Public Holiday |
6-Sep | Saturday | Defence Day | Observance |
22-Sep | Monday | September Equinox | Season |
30-Sep | Tuesday | Durga Puja | Optional Holiday |
2-Oct | Thursday | Dussehra | Optional Holiday |
7-Oct | Tuesday | Birthday of Guru Balmik Sawami Ji | Optional Holiday |
20-Oct | Monday | Diwali/Deepavali | Optional Holiday |
9-Nov | Sunday | Iqbal Day | Public Holiday |
21-Dec | Sunday | December Solstice | Season |
24-Dec | Wednesday | Christmas Eve | Observance |
25-Dec | Thursday | Christmas Day | Public Holiday |
25-Dec | Thursday | Quaid-e-Azam Day | Public Holiday |
26-Dec | Friday | Day After Christmas (Christians only) | Optional Holiday |
31-Dec | Wednesday | New Year’s Eve | Observance |
A Government servant should not ordinarily be refused an Optional Holiday that is of religious significance to him and the refusal is likely to decrease the number of such holidays to which she/ he is entitled. The Public and Optional Holidays for the year 2025 regarding festivals of Muslims and Minorities for the Calendar Year 2025 would be as under:
Note:
In the case of Muslim Festivals, the dates of Holidays are based on anticipated dates and are subject to the appearance of the moon for which separate notification will be issued by M/o Interior.
